just in time for vegan pizza day, mohawk bend in echo park has changed their menu and rolled out some new and exciting vegan pizzas. we hit them up yesterday and tried what turned out to be the best pie i’ve eaten in ages: asparagus and potato with caramelized onions, garlic, and leek purée. genius!
they also have a new VEGAN BANH MI pizza that comes with tofu and sriracha aioli. you know that’s what i’m getting next time.

heads up: mohawk in echo park recently hired a new awesome chef (garbs!) and he’s been upping the bar for vegan food in LA ever since. i’ve been in awe of the cauliflower buffalo wings for a while, but now he’s busting out original vegan pizza creations each week for meatless mondays.
last week’s (pictured above) was so epic that it may even find a place on the normal menu soon! it consisted of: hanger 24 winter warmer BBQ sauce, vidalia onions, braised collard greens, sliced potatoes, and incredibly creamy “blue cheese”…
